Join our clients dynamic P&I department as a Claims Executive at their Newcastle office. In this captivating role, you'll take charge of a diverse array of P&I claims, including intricate and challenging cases, from initiation to resolution.

Your primary responsibilities will encompass:

  • Assessing the validity of claims against P&I Rules and member terms.Maintaining meticulous records, including Claims Summary Documents and Estimate Review (ESR), ensuring accuracy and timeliness.
  • Managing claim processing and inquiries, engaging with members throughout the process.
  • Opportunities for domestic and international travel to foster relationships with members and brokers.
  • Handling claims efficiently and cost-effectively.
  • Collaborating closely with the Loss Prevention Department on claims and vessel assessments, involving the FD&D Department when necessary.
  • Alerting the Underwriting Department to any notable risks identified.
  • Taking ownership of additional projects and activities within the P&I department, such as Sector and Expertise Groups, training, and member relations.

Essential Skills/Qualifications/Experience:

  • Degree (preferably in Law) or equivalent, such as a Master Mariner's Certificate.
  • Proficiency in IT, particularly MS Office suite, with adaptability to new technologies.
  • Strong interpersonal skills suitable for diverse cultural contexts, adept at verbal and written communication.
  • Flexibility to accommodate client needs and collaborate effectively with colleagues across geographical sectors.

Preferred Skills/Qualifications/Experience:

  • Prior experience in shipping law or the maritime industry.
  • Willingness to travel as required.
